Transaction

26858af2271add6d73ff84839c3a199ceeb4d5a38d43abfc920466429e0e73dd

Summary

In Block471113
TimeTue, 05 Dec 2023 16:23:30 UTC
Total Input659.46806031 Nebula
Total Output693.46806031 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
494765 Confirmations693.46806031 Nebula
Raw Transaction